Light Ripper Strain Overview
Light Ripper is a sativa-dominant hybrid cannabis strain developed by Irie Genetics through the careful crossing of the legendary P-91 and Jack the Ripper genetics. This strain represents the fusion of two powerful lineages: P-91, a balanced hybrid derived from Northern Lights crossed with itself three times (cubing process), known for its potent effects and uplifting characteristics; and Jack the Ripper, a flagship strain from Subcool's The Dank renowned for its intense lemon-pine aroma and energizing effects. Light Ripper typically exhibits approximately 70% sativa genetics with a balanced indica foundation that prevents excessive cerebral overstimulation.
The strain produces tall, bushy plants with stretchy characteristics and dense flower production. Buds feature a rich green coloration with vibrant orange pistils and generous trichome coverage, creating an attractive frost-like appearance. The aromatic profile is dominated by bright citrus notes, particularly lemon and lime, complemented by pine undertones and a distinctive skunky character with musky lingering notes reminiscent of dryer sheets. This complex terpene profile contributes to both its therapeutic potential and recreational appeal among cannabis enthusiasts seeking creative enhancement.

Light Ripper Strain Growing Information
Light Ripper has a flowering time of 56-63 days (8-9 weeks), making it a relatively quick-growing option for cultivators. Plants exhibit tall, bushy growth patterns with significant stretch during the flowering phase, requiring adequate vertical space and support for heavy flower production. The strain offers moderate yields and is suitable for both indoor and outdoor cultivation. Growers should implement early training techniques such as topping and low-stress training (LST) to maximize light exposure and manage plant height. Good ventilation is essential to prevent mold issues due to the dense flower structure. The strain responds well to soil-focused growing methods and benefits from careful attention to nutrient management during the flowering phase.
